Output ef22ae91e10997477ef3258164c9fd11545f0331ac7df62ec00b0b0ca78f39d1:8

value
100551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c22311adfdd30b8f45af0b8357c63b73e6a441c OP_EQUAL
address
3D1Ng26mWfDQ4BSVQyB4d7wcCkvg3FRhVN
transaction
ef22ae91e10997477ef3258164c9fd11545f0331ac7df62ec00b0b0ca78f39d1
confirmations
86571
spent
true